Hey there, I have a Moen faucet (2017) that is driving me bonkers with low flow. Looks like their Medina model, with a slightly different handle shape.

It's been trouble almost from the start. Our building has old pipes (1950's condos), but the supply pipes coming out of the wall are putting out great flow. 3 something GPM. Faucet is putting out 0.5-0.8 GPM.

I have:
-Checked the supply from the wall (very good)
-Checked the flow of the faucet with the sprayer head removed (it is a slight improvement, about 0.2 gpm)
-Cleaned the little filter basket in the spray head
-Replaced the cartridge with a new cartridge from Moen

When Moen shipped me a new cartridge (free, which is great of them), suddenly my faucet shaped up for 2 weeks and had a normal flow (where was that the last 2 years?). The day I went to install the part 2 weeks later, the flow died back down to its meagre rate, before I had touched the faucet to install.

Does anything explain this bizarre faucet behavior? The new cartridge did nothing different.
